I'd like to hard anodize some fork tubes, can anyone recommend a local hard anodizer here in LA, possibly on the west side?  Any idea how much those might/should run for?

I've used Plateronics Processing in Chatsworth about 8 times for hard anodizing in the past 5 years and they always do a great job.  One set of fork tubes usually runs $60-$80.

We use LNL Anodizing in Sun Valley.  They do a lot of single part work...have seen motorcyle and hot-rod stuff there.
